Transaction 2715912b36e74b2a5bf39bc7131051ce8c430ab8fc7e9613b2a36b089f2ae6b1
1 Input
1 Output
-
2715912b36e74b2a5bf39bc7131051ce8c430ab8fc7e9613b2a36b089f2ae6b1:0
- value
- 3350515
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21d7a931432aa86284b50bb459782e65ac24071a OP_EQUAL
- address
- 34mxaFquhLdTBJxX8fscUtYXjqfkKkpABS